The global dehumidifier market is experiencing steady growth, driven by rising awareness of indoor air quality, increased industrial applications, and climate-related concerns. Dehumidifiers are used across residential, commercial, and industrial spaces to control humidity, prevent mold growth, and maintain comfort and health. Technological advancements and smart home integration are also shaping market trends.
The global dehumidifier market generated USD 3.28 billion revenue in 2023 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 6.58% from 2024 to 2033. The burgeoning adoption of household dehumidifiers for moisture control, bacteria, and mold prevention is a significant driver propelling the market forward.

Rising Awareness of Indoor Air Quality: Growing health concerns related to mold, dust mites, and damp environments are increasing demand.
-
Climate Change and Humidity Issues: Warmer and more humid climates are driving adoption, especially in tropical and subtropical regions.
-
Growth of Residential Construction: More homes and apartments, especially in humid regions, lead to increased dehumidifier installations.
-
Industrial & Commercial Usage: Sectors like pharmaceuticals, food storage, and data centers require strict humidity control.
-
Smart Home Integration: Connected devices and IoT-enabled dehumidifiers offer remote control, automation, and energy efficiency.
-
High Initial and Maintenance Costs: Upfront pricing and energy consumption can deter cost-sensitive consumers.
-
Noise and Size Constraints: Especially in residential applications, larger or louder units can be undesirable.
-
Seasonal Demand: Sales often peak in warm/humid seasons, making the market somewhat cyclical.
-
Limited Awareness in Emerging Economies: In some developing regions, the benefits of dehumidifiers are still not widely recognized.
-
North America: One of the largest markets; high adoption in the U.S. and Canada due to awareness and climate conditions.
-
Europe: Strong demand in countries with temperate and humid climates like the UK, Germany, and the Netherlands.
-
Asia-Pacific: Fastest-growing region due to rapid urbanization, industrialization, and humid weather conditions, especially in China, India, and Southeast Asia.
-
Latin America & Middle East: Moderate growth; adoption is increasing in hospitality and commercial sectors.
